Output bf2f3a6d63d24194e63fc6f8156aed1f31eab2da331160b3d5e8ef97ae24c76a:25

value
27525874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 160893fb160f2690f4b79f96fd058a7d1a12b32a OP_EQUALVERIFY OP_CHECKSIG
address
131W9EYwhZRvNUKxLA45MkDcdYmKEzfFeZ
transaction
bf2f3a6d63d24194e63fc6f8156aed1f31eab2da331160b3d5e8ef97ae24c76a
spent
true